8 Halifaxes from 408 and 427 Squadrons were joined by 12 Wellingtons from 429, 431, and 432 Squadrons on a mining operation to Brest, St. Nazaire, and the Frisian Islands. The crews were over the gardens at between 500 and 3,000 feet, sowing 44@1500 lb mines.
All crews from 408 Squadron landed at Colerne, Beaulieu, or Thorney Island on return due to poor weather at base.
Sgt R. Henry from 427 Squadron landed at Beaulieu on return due to poor
weather at base.
W/O K. Mills from 429 Squadron landed at Lyneham on return due to a
fuel shortage.
All crews from 431 Squadron landed at Colerne on return due to poor weather at base.
Sgt W. Taylor from 432 Squadron returned without mining as they could
not find the pinpoint.
